Moringa and Testosterone: Superfood or is it?

moringa leaves, powder, and tea

Medical Review by Gerardo Sison, PharmD Moringa Oleifera (also called miracle tree, the tree of life, and drumstick tree) grows in Asia and some African countries. It’s highly nutritious and resistant to environmental factors, which has made it an important food crop in its areas of cultivation. Due to Moringas high amount of antioxidants and…

Read More